Abstract

An increasing number of studies focus on the effectiveness of Massive Open Online Courses (MOOC)-based blended learning, whereas none have yet studied using it for teaching fundamental nursing skills at an undergraduate level.To evaluate the effectiveness of MOOC-based blended learning versus face-to-face classroom teaching techniques within the fundamental nursing course at the Faculty of Nursing, University of Xiang Nan, China.This cluster randomized controlled trial enrolled 181 students and assigned them into either an MOOC-based blended or a face-to-face classroom teaching group, both involving the Fundamental Nursing course for undergraduate nursing students. The analyzed outcomes included test scores, critical thinking ability, and feedback received from the students on the Fundamental Nursing course.MOOC-based blended techniques versus face-to-face classroom teaching methods demonstrated higher daily performance (P = .014), operational performance (P = .001), theoretical achievements (P < .001), and final grades (P < .001) in Fundamental Nursing.Moreover, the mean change in the participants' critical thinking ability items between groups were, mostly, statistically significant. The items focusing on the feedback from the students demonstrated significant differences between the groups in terms of their satisfaction with the teaching they received (P < .001) and the overall learning effects (P = .030).This study confirmed that receiving MOOC-based blended learning was superior when compared against face-to-face classroom teaching techniques for learning within the Fundamental Nursing course.

摘要

越来越多的研究关注大规模开放在线课程(MOOC)为基础的混合式学习的有效性,然而,还没有人研究过将其用于中国湘南大学护理学院本科基础护理技能的教学。

评估 MOOC 为基础的混合式学习与传统面对面课堂教学技术在湘南大学护理学院基础护理课程中的有效性。这项整群随机对照试验纳入了 181 名学生,将他们分配到 MOOC 为基础的混合式学习组或传统面对面课堂教学组,两组均接受本科护理学生的基础护理课程。分析的结果包括考试成绩、批判性思维能力以及学生对基础护理课程的反馈。

MOOC 为基础的混合式学习技术与传统面对面课堂教学方法相比,在基础护理方面表现出更高的日常表现(P=0.014)、操作表现(P=0.001)、理论成绩(P<0.001)和最终成绩(P<0.001)。此外,参与者在批判性思维能力项目上的平均变化在组间大多具有统计学意义。重点关注学生反馈的项目在他们对所接受教学的满意度(P<0.001)和整体学习效果(P=0.030)方面存在显著差异。

本研究证实,与传统面对面课堂教学技术相比,在基础护理课程中接受 MOOC 为基础的混合式学习具有优势。
